Washington Redskins rookie wide receiver Terry McLaurin has just introduced himself to the Philadelphia Eagles, and with it, the entirety of the NFL. He ran right past cornerback Rasul Douglas, getting wide open for quarterback Case Keenum to hit him in stride.

McLaurin, a product of the Ohio State Buckeyes, was drafted in the third round. Known as being a burner, he showed the exact skill-set he was drafted to do on the play. It was his second catch on the day.

The Redskins are now up 17-0 over Philadelphia.
